The Rastriya Swatantra Party (RSP) has called a meeting of its parliamentary party members on Saturday morning at 9 AM. According to party spokesperson and lawmaker Manish Jha, the meeting will focus on the recent visit visa scandal that has caused a big political uproar in the country.
The RSP has been strongly raising this issue both inside and outside Parliament. The party is demanding the resignation of Home Minister Ramesh Lekhak, claiming he has a role in the visa scam. They believe he should step down immediately to allow a fair investigation.
In response to the scandal, the government has formed an investigation committee led by former Chief Secretary Shanker Das Bairagi. However, the RSP has rejected this committee. They argue that it is neither independent nor trustworthy, and say it was formed to protect those involved.
The visa scam has become a serious national issue, and RSP says it will continue to fight until the truth comes out and action is taken against those responsible.
